Yeah, this is because put_prev_task_scx() uses task_is_blocked(p), and we should
use p->is_blocked instead, since task_is_blocked() can become true before the
task has actually been processed as blocked by the scheduler.
I've fixed this in my local tree, this should disappear in the next version.
